Overall, the Brehon is an amazingly relaxing place, the perfect hotel to go to for a weekend where you just want to take it easy and be pampered - there's absolutely no need to leave the building. The staff in the hotel, restaurant and spa were all exceptionally helpful and polite. I defo will return as this Hotel is one of the best I have stayed while holidaying in Ireland.
